Modernism

• From late 90th century to early 20th century.• Set of cultural tendencies and arrangement of

associated cultural movement.• Victorian conventions were broken away.• Chris Baldick says:

“Modernist literature is characterized chiefly by a rejection of 19th-century traditions and of their consensus between author and reader.”

New-Historicism

• Developed in 1980s.• Stephen Greenblatt.• Basic idea: history

with literary text.• Parallel reading of

literary text and history.

“Text is historical and history is textual.”

-Michael Wallner

“(New Historicism) is combined interest in the textuality of history, the historicity of text.”

-Louis Montrose

New Historicism involves “an intensified willingness to read all of the textual traces of the past with the attention traditionally conferred only on literary text”

-Stephen Greenblatt• Foucault and idea of ‘episteme’.
